The Russian Plot to Kill a German CEO

Russian hybrid warfare, encompassing sabotage and critical infrastructure attacks, significantly intensified following the Ukraine invasion, reaching a peak last year. This escalation included targeting key figures such as Rheinmetall CEO Armin Papperger, highlighting the direct threat to European defense industry leaders central to the continent's rearmament efforts and signaling heightened operational risks for strategic industrial assets.

Analysis

The operational environment for the European defense industry has deteriorated significantly, marked by an escalation in Russian hybrid warfare tactics post-Ukraine invasion. These activities, which reached a 'fever pitch' last year, have moved beyond general disinformation and now include sabotage and targeted attacks on critical infrastructure. The specific targeting of Rheinmetall's CEO, Armin Papperger, underscores a strategic shift towards personalizing threats against key executives instrumental in Europe's rearmament. This development transforms abstract geopolitical tensions into tangible operational and security risks for pivotal defense contractors, signaling that corporate leadership and strategic assets are now considered direct targets in the conflict.
